This lower level unit of the owner's sweet log cabin is tucked away at the end of a wooded lane. Newly renovated and outfitted with everything you'll need for a few days of relaxing along the river, it's a great spot for a getaway in any season.
This cozy one-bedroom hideaway is the perfect couple's escape or a quiet place to stay . Featuring a gorgeous view of the river that can be enjoyed from any room in the cottage or while lounging on the patio, nature lovers can enjoy the birds and wildlife throughout the year.
The one-bedroom suite offers a comfortable entertainment area with big screen TV & games table, fold-out queen-size futon for up to 2 additional guests, dining set and kitchenette with a portable cooktop (no stove/oven). There is a BBQ available on the patio year-round for grilling as well. The 3-piece bathroom is accessible from the bedroom and kitchen hallway.
The Burnt River is a peaceful area, perfect for canoe & kayaking enthusiasts. Follow the river down into the town of Kinmount or explore 3 Brother's Falls upriver, or simply paddle around and explore. The Haliburton Rail Trail is just steps from the cottage. Available year round for Hiking, Biking, ATVing and Snowmobiling with a valid visitors pass. Ritchie Fall's & Furnace Falls are a quick 10 min drive away.
You can launch a small boat from the property or enjoy the watercraft provided by the owners. There is a gradual entry from the shore, be sure to bring your water shoes if you'd rather walk in or have fun jumping off the dock and take advantage of the dock ladder for a steadier exit.
